Description

Lenivia is a caninised monoclonal antibody (mAb) that targets Nerve Growth Factor (NGF), a key protein involved in pain signalling and inflammation. By neutralising NGF, izenivetmab helps to interrupt the pain signals, providing effective and targeted relief for dogs suffering from osteoarthritis.

FAQ

What is Lenivia 2.0 mg Solution for Injection for Dogs used for?

Lenivia 2.0 mg Solution for Injection for Dogs is used for the alleviation of pain associated with osteoarthritis in dogs. It helps improve their comfort and mobility.

How does izenivetmab work to relieve pain?

Izenivetmab, the active ingredient in Lenivia, is a monoclonal antibody that binds to Nerve Growth Factor (NGF). NGF is a protein that plays a key role in pain signalling and inflammation. By blocking NGF, izenivetmab helps reduce the pain signals, providing targeted relief for osteoarthritis.

How often should my dog receive Lenivia injections?

Lenivia is administered as a subcutaneous injection once monthly. Your veterinary surgeon will determine the exact dosage based on your dog's body weight.

Are there any age restrictions for using Lenivia in dogs?

Yes, Lenivia should not be used in dogs less than 12 months of age. Always consult your vet to ensure this treatment is suitable for your dog.

Can Lenivia be used for pregnant or breeding dogs?

No, Lenivia is contraindicated for use in pregnant and lactating bitches, as well as in breeding animals.

Warnings

It is crucial to be aware of the following warnings and precautions when using Lenivia 2.0 mg Solution for Injection for Dogs:

Contraindications:

  • Do not use in dogs younger than 12 months of age.
  • Do not use in pregnant or lactating bitches.
  • Do not use in breeding animals.
  • Do not use if there is a known hypersensitivity to izenivetmab or any of the excipients.

Special Warnings:

  • This product may lead to the development of anti-drug antibodies, which could reduce its effectiveness. If your dog's condition does not improve, discuss alternative treatments with your vet.
  • Lenivia contains izenivetmab, a canine monoclonal antibody (mAb). Studies with similar anti-NGF antibodies have shown potential effects on the female reproductive system and foetal development.
  • The safety and efficacy in puppies under 12 months, or in dogs with kidney or liver disease, have not been fully established. Use in these cases should be carefully considered by your vet based on a benefit-risk assessment.

Special Precautions for Use in Animals:

  • A small percentage of dogs may not respond fully to izenivetmab. Your veterinary surgeon should monitor your dog monthly for changes in osteoarthritis pain.
  • Safety data beyond 6 months of treatment has not been evaluated.

Special Precautions for Persons Administering the Product:

  • Accidental self-injection may cause hypersensitivity reactions, including anaphylaxis. Repeated accidental self-injection increases this risk.
  • Pregnant women, women attempting to conceive, or nursing women should exercise extreme caution to prevent accidental self-injection.
  • In case of accidental self-injection, seek immediate medical advice and show the package leaflet or label to the doctor.

Adverse Reactions:

Commonly observed side effects in clinical studies include:

  • Slight redness, swelling, and heat at the injection site.
  • Nausea, diarrhoea, vomiting.
  • Increased thirst.
  • Lethargy.

If you notice any serious effects or other effects not mentioned, please inform your veterinary surgeon.

Ingredients

Each ml of Lenivia 2.0 mg Solution for Injection for Dogs contains:

  • Active substance: Izenivetmab 2.0 mg/ml
  • Excipients:
    • Disodium phosphate heptahydrate
    • Sodium dihydrogen phosphate dihydrate
    • Sodium chloride
    • Polysorbate 80
    • Water for injections
